Bedust

/bɪˈdʌst/ verb

to cover with dust or make dusty; to coat with fine particles.

From be- (thorough prefix) + dust (from Old Norse dúst or Old English dust, related to Old High German dunst 'vapor'). The verb means to cover thoroughly with dust.
